Presiunea pe acuratețe și timp de răspuns în EDI a crescut vizibil în ultimul an, pe fondul extinderii obligațiilor de e-facturare în UE și al cerințelor tot mai stricte din retail și automotive. În România, e-Factura a devenit obligatorie pentru toate tranzacțiile B2B interne de la 1 iulie 2024, după o perioadă de raportare tranzitorie în H1 2024, forțând companiile să-și revizuiască fluxurile de date și controlul de calitate. La nivel global, piața EDI a fost evaluată la aproximativ 2 miliarde USD în 2022 și este așteptată să crească cu o rată anuală de peste 10% până în 2030 (sursa: Grand View Research, 2023), semn că EDI rămâne infrastructură critică pentru lanțurile de aprovizionare.
De ce calitatea datelor în EDI contează operațional
În retail și FMCG, unde jucători ca Carrefour, Kaufland, Metro sau Auchan rulează zeci de mii de mesaje EDI pe zi (ORDERS, DESADV, INVOIC), un singur defect de structură sau de codificare poate bloca recepția, planificarea livrărilor sau decontarea. În automotive, rețele precum Volkswagen Group, BMW sau Renault Group folosesc standarde UN/EDIFACT, Odette și VDA; orice întârziere în confirmarea tehnică poate propaga riscuri în producție just-in-time. Aici intervine mesajul CONTRL: răspunsul standardizat, la nivel de sintaxă și structură, care oferă partenerului feedback rapid dacă un interchange, un grup funcțional sau un mesaj EDI a fost acceptat, acceptat cu observații sau respins.
CONTRL pe scurt: ce este și ce nu este
- CONTRL este un mesaj de serviciu UN/EDIFACT, definit în directoarele UNECE/CEFACT (ex. D.96A, D.01B), folosit pentru acknowledged tehnic. Structura include segmente precum UCI (interchange response), UCF (functional group response) și UCM (message response) cu coduri standardizate pentru severitate și erori.
- CONTRL nu confirmă logica de business. Pentru confirmări la nivel de aplicație (ex. „linia 3 din comandă e invalidă din cauza codului GTIN”), se utilizează APERAK în EDI sau mesaje dedicate (ex. ORDRSP pentru confirmarea comenzii).
- Nu confunda CONTRL cu MDN în AS2. MDN confirmă doar transportul și integritatea la nivel de canal (transport-level), în timp ce CONTRL validează sintaxa/structura EDI (application-level technical ack).
- Analog în ANSI X12, rolul este similar cu 997/999 Functional Acknowledgment, însă în Europa, în ecosistemele EDIFACT/EANCOM, echivalentul uzual este CONTRL.
Modelul de feedback rapid: cum proiectezi un loop sănătos
- Validează devreme și automat. La recepția unui interchange EDIFACT (UNB…UNZ), parsează și validează imediat. Separă clar erorile de transport (AS2/FTP), de erorile de sintaxă EDI (ex. separatori, UNH/UNT nealiniate), de erorile de structură (segmente lipsă sau ordine incorectă conform directory-ului).
- Generează CONTRL în câteva minute. Regula de aur: pentru orice mesaj EDI primit, trimite CONTRL tehnic cât mai aproape de timp real. În practică, multe organizații vizează sub 5 minute pentru 95% dintre mesaje. Astfel, partenerul poate relansa rapid sau corecta fluxul.
- Mapează corect referințele. Include în UCI/UCM identificatorii din UNB/UNH (ex. Message Reference Number, Data Interchange Control Reference), astfel încât partenerul să poată corela univoc ack-ul cu mesajul sursă.
- Clasifică severitatea. Trimite Accepted, Accepted with warnings, Rejected în conformitate cu codurile standard; păstrează în loguri detalii granularizate: segment, poziție, cod de eroare, descriere.
- Separă tehnic de business. Dacă mesajul trece de nivelul tehnic, dar cade în regulile de aplicație, emite APERAK cu detalii de business. Mulți retaileri europeni (în EANCOM) se așteaptă la acest pattern.
- Corelează cu canalele operaționale. Trimite alerte automate în Teams/Slack/Jira când rata de Reject depășește pragul; asigură closed-loop RCA și auto-replay acolo unde e sigur.
Implementare: detalii tehnice utile
- Directories și subseturi: aliniați validarea cu versiunea folosită (ex. UN/EDIFACT D.01B sau EANCOM 2002/2012). Un mix necontrolat de subseturi (ex. EANCOM vs. standard full) produce false negative.
- Reguli de separatori: respectați UNA și evitați coliziunile de caractere. Diferențele de encoding (UTF-8 vs. ISO-8859-2) pot genera reject-uri tehnice greu de diagnosticat.
- Profiluri per partener: marii retaileri (Carrefour, Kaufland, Metro) au ghiduri EDI specifice. Implementați „validation packs” pe partener, nu doar pe tip de mesaj.
- Transport: pe AS2, folosiți semnare și criptare; acceptați MDN sincron/asynchron. Rețineți: MDN „Received OK” nu înseamnă că EDI a trecut validarea — CONTRL decide asta.
- Observabilitate: urmăriți KPI precum First-Time-Right (FTR) pe mesaj EDI, rata de Reject pe tip de mesaj, TTA (time-to-ack) median/95p, și rata de reemisii. Un FTR peste 98% este un semn bun în ecosisteme stabile.
Exemple din teren
În retail, un flux tipic ORDERS → DESADV → INVOIC are succes doar dacă fiecare verigă primește rapid CONTRL pentru confirmarea tehnică. Furnizorii care au activat generarea automată de CONTRL la recepția ORDERS reduc timpii de remediere de la ore la minute. În automotive, Odette recomandă folosirea sistematică a acknowledge-urilor tehnice pentru a evita blocajele în livrările secvențiale JIT/JIS.
Pe piața locală, unii furnizori EDI integrează aceste bune practici by design. De exemplu, există soluții care trimit CONTRL automat după parsare și expun dashboard-uri cu TTA și Reject rate. În unele implementări, un modul EDI integrat în CRM sau ERP face exact acest lucru; de pildă, soluții locale precum EDIconnect.ro (ca modul al CRMconnect) oferă rutare, validare și feedback standardizat pentru partenerii EDI, util mai ales în contextul B2B românesc post-2024.
Checklist rapid pentru echipele EDI/ERP
- Activați „acknowledgement request” în UNB conform acordului cu partenerii.
- Automatizați generarea CONTRL la fiecare nivel relevant (interchange/grup/mesaj).
- Implementați APERAK pentru erori de business; nu supraîncărcați CONTRL cu semantici de aplicație.
- Mențineți mapări și validatoare sincronizate cu versiunile de directory/subset ale partenerilor.
- Monitorizați TTA și Reject rate; stabiliți praguri și acțiuni automate.
Concluzie
Într-o lume în care EDI susține procese critice, CONTRL este instrumentul cel mai simplu și mai eficient pentru a închide bucla de feedback tehnic în câteva minute. Diferența dintre un parteneriat sănătos și unul plin de fricțiuni stă adesea în calitatea și viteza acestor acknowledge-uri. Standardele UN/EDIFACT și bunele practici EANCOM, dublate de observabilitate și automatizare, oferă baza pentru calitatea datelor în EDI și pentru operațiuni robuste, de la retail la automotive.
